Shilpa tipped by bookies to win reality TV show

Bollywood star Shilpa Shetty is favourite to win a British reality television show this weekend.

Bollywood star Shilpa Shetty is favourite to win a British reality television show this weekend, following a diplomatic storm over alleged racist bullying of the Indian actress.

Bookies were quoting odds of 4/11 on the Indian actress emerging the winner on Sunday of "Celebrity Big Brother," which triggered a row drawing in the Indian and British governments earlier this month.

Her main perceived tormentor, Jade Goody, was evicted last week days after the row erupted following foul-mouthed exchanges on the programme, a version of the Big Brother format which has been a worldwide hit.

Two other female "housemates" who were seen as having bullied the Indian actress may leave as early as Friday evening, when two more of the remaining eight contestants in the house are due to be evicted.

According to bookmaker Betdirect, former Miss Great Britain Danielle Lloyd and singer Jo O'Meara of S Club 7 fame are the most likely to be thrown out by a public vote on Friday evening, their odds of winning put at 66/1 and 150/1 respectively.
